이미지는 예시일 수 있습니다.
제품 세부사항은 사양을 확인하세요.
PIC16C74B-04I/L

PIC16C74B-04I/L

Product Overview

Category

The PIC16C74B-04I/L belongs to the category of microcontrollers.

Use

This microcontroller is commonly used in various electronic devices and embedded systems for controlling and processing data.

Characteristics

  • Low power consumption
  • High performance
  • Compact size
  • Versatile functionality

Package

The PIC16C74B-04I/L is available in a 40-pin PDIP (Plastic Dual In-line Package) package.

Essence

The essence of this microcontroller lies in its ability to provide efficient control and processing capabilities in a compact form factor.

Packaging/Quantity

The PIC16C74B-04I/L is typically packaged in reels or tubes, with a quantity of 1000 units per reel/tube.

Specifications

  • Architecture: 8-bit
  • CPU Speed: 4 MHz
  • Program Memory Size: 4 KB
  • RAM Size: 192 bytes
  • Number of I/O Pins: 33
  • ADC Channels: 8
  • Timers: 3
  • Communication Interfaces: USART, SPI, I2C

Detailed Pin Configuration

The PIC16C74B-04I/L has a total of 40 pins. The pin configuration is as follows:

  1. VDD - Power supply voltage
  2. RA0 - General-purpose I/O pin
  3. RA1 - General-purpose I/O pin
  4. RA2 - General-purpose I/O pin
  5. RA3 - General-purpose I/O pin
  6. RA4 - General-purpose I/O pin
  7. RA5 - General-purpose I/O pin
  8. MCLR - Master Clear input
  9. VSS - Ground
  10. RB0 - General-purpose I/O pin
  11. RB1 - General-purpose I/O pin
  12. RB2 - General-purpose I/O pin
  13. RB3 - General-purpose I/O pin
  14. RB4 - General-purpose I/O pin
  15. RB5 - General-purpose I/O pin
  16. RB6 - General-purpose I/O pin
  17. RB7 - General-purpose I/O pin
  18. VDD - Power supply voltage
  19. OSC1 - Oscillator input
  20. OSC2 - Oscillator output
  21. RC0 - General-purpose I/O pin
  22. RC1 - General-purpose I/O pin
  23. RC2 - General-purpose I/O pin
  24. RC3 - General-purpose I/O pin
  25. RC4 - General-purpose I/O pin
  26. RC5 - General-purpose I/O pin
  27. RC6 - General-purpose I/O pin
  28. RC7 - General-purpose I/O pin
  29. VSS - Ground
  30. RD0 - General-purpose I/O pin
  31. RD1 - General-purpose I/O pin
  32. RD2 - General-purpose I/O pin
  33. RD3 - General-purpose I/O pin
  34. RD4 - General-purpose I/O pin
  35. RD5 - General-purpose I/O pin
  36. RD6 - General-purpose I/O pin
  37. RD7 - General-purpose I/O pin
  38. VDD - Power supply voltage
  39. VSS - Ground
  40. RB3/PGM - Programming mode select

Functional Features

The PIC16C74B-04I/L offers the following functional features:

  • High-speed processing capabilities
  • On-chip memory for program storage
  • Built-in timers and communication interfaces
  • Analog-to-Digital Converter (ADC) for sensor interfacing
  • General-purpose Input/Output (GPIO) pins for external device control

Advantages and Disadvantages

Advantages

  • Low power consumption, suitable for battery-powered applications
  • Compact size allows for integration in space-constrained designs
  • Versatile functionality enables a wide range of applications
  • Cost-effective solution for embedded systems

Disadvantages

  • Limited program memory size may restrict complex application development
  • Lack of advanced features compared to more modern microcontrollers
  • Limited number of I/O pins may require additional external circuitry for larger projects

Working Principles

The PIC16C74B-04I/L operates based on the principles of a Harvard architecture microcontroller. It executes instructions stored in its program memory and interacts with external devices through its I/O pins. The microcontroller's central processing unit (CPU) performs calculations, controls data flow, and manages peripheral devices.

Detailed Application Field Plans

The PIC16C74B-04I/L finds applications in various fields, including:

  1. Home automation systems
  2. Industrial control systems
  3. Automotive electronics
  4. Medical devices
  5. Consumer electronics
  6. Internet of Things (IoT) devices

Detailed and Complete Alternative Models

Some alternative

기술 솔루션에 PIC16C74B-04I/L 적용과 관련된 10가지 일반적인 질문과 답변을 나열하세요.

  1. What is the maximum operating frequency of PIC16C74B-04I/L?
    - The maximum operating frequency of PIC16C74B-04I/L is 4 MHz.

  2. What are the key features of PIC16C74B-04I/L?
    - The key features of PIC16C74B-04I/L include 33 I/O pins, 192 bytes of RAM, and 4K words of program memory.

  3. Can PIC16C74B-04I/L be used in battery-powered applications?
    - Yes, PIC16C74B-04I/L can be used in battery-powered applications due to its low power consumption.

  4. Is PIC16C74B-04I/L suitable for real-time control applications?
    - Yes, PIC16C74B-04I/L is suitable for real-time control applications due to its fast instruction execution and interrupt handling capabilities.

  5. What development tools are available for programming PIC16C74B-04I/L?
    - Development tools such as MPLAB IDE and PICkit programmers are commonly used for programming PIC16C74B-04I/L.

  6. Can PIC16C74B-04I/L communicate with other devices using serial communication protocols?
    - Yes, PIC16C74B-04I/L supports serial communication protocols such as UART and SPI, enabling it to communicate with other devices.

  7. How can I interface sensors with PIC16C74B-04I/L?
    - Sensors can be interfaced with PIC16C74B-04I/L using its built-in analog-to-digital converter (ADC) and digital I/O pins.

  8. What are the available timer modules in PIC16C74B-04I/L?
    - PIC16C74B-04I/L features multiple timer modules including Timer0, Timer1, and Timer2, which can be used for various timing and counting applications.

  9. Can PIC16C74B-04I/L be used in temperature monitoring systems?
    - Yes, PIC16C74B-04I/L can be used in temperature monitoring systems by interfacing it with temperature sensors and displaying the data on an output device.

  10. Are there any application notes or reference designs available for PIC16C74B-04I/L?
    - Yes, Microchip provides application notes and reference designs for PIC16C74B-04I/L, offering guidance on various technical solutions and implementations.